Exterior Shutters Painting in Waco, TX
Exterior shutters painting services involve refreshing the appearance and protecting the shutters on a property’s exterior through professional painting. This service typically covers a variety of shutter types, including wood, vinyl, or composite materials, and can be applied to both decorative and functional shutters. Homeowners often seek this service to enhance curb appeal, restore faded or chipped paint, or update the color scheme of their home's exterior. Before requesting exterior shutters painting, property owners should consider the current condition of the shutters, whether any repairs are needed prior to painting, and the desired finish or color to achieve the desired aesthetic.
Property owners should also understand the importance of proper surface preparation, such as cleaning and sanding, to ensure long-lasting results. It's helpful to inquire about the types of paints or finishes used, especially if the shutters are exposed to harsh weather conditions. Additionally, understanding the scope of the project-whether it includes multiple sets of shutters or specific areas-can aid in planning. Clear communication about expectations and the existing condition of the shutters can help ensure the final outcome aligns with the property's style and maintenance needs.

Exterior Shutters Painting Questions
What types of exterior shutters can be painted? Various materials such as wood, vinyl, and composite shutters can be painted to refresh their appearance and protect the surface.
Is it necessary to prep shutters before painting? Yes, cleaning and sanding the shutters help ensure proper paint adhesion and a smooth finish.
How often should exterior shutters be repainted? Repainting is typically recommended every few years to maintain appearance and prevent weather-related damage.
What colors are suitable for exterior shutter painting? Neutral and classic colors like black, white, or navy are popular choices, but color options depend on the property's style and personal preference.
